The Quintanar Gravel Adventure


A gravel cycling route starting from Miguel Esteban

An exhilarating gravel ride through the charming towns of La Mancha

Map

Explore the picturesque region of La Mancha on this challenging gravel ride starting near Miguel Esteban. Covering a distance of 111 kilometers and with an ascent of 834 meters, this route takes you through the idyllic towns of Quintanar de la Orden, Hontanaya, Osa de la Vega, Pinillo, Los Hinojosos, and El Toboso. Get ready to be enchanted by the beautiful landscapes, historical monuments, and the renowned windmills made famous by Cervantes' Don Quixote. This route is suitable for experienced gravel riders looking for an adventure in the heart of Spain.

Quintanar de la OrdenTown
Make a stop in Quintanar de la Orden to visit the impressive Palacio Fuentes, a historic building dating back to the 16th century.
HontanayaVillage
Hontanaya offers a charming town square surrounded by well-preserved medieval architecture and a peaceful atmosphere.
Osa de la VegaVillage
In Osa de la Vega, don't miss the Church of Santa Ana, a beautiful example of Gothic architecture.
Pinillo940 mPeak
The village of Pinillo is known for its traditional pottery, visit the local artisans to see their craft.
Los HinojososVillage
As you pass through Los Hinojosos, take a moment to admire the traditional Manchego architecture and discover the local gastronomy.
El TobosoVillage
El Toboso is famous for being the inspiration behind the fictional home of Don Quixote's beloved Dulcinea. Visit the Cueva de Dulcinea, a museum dedicated to the fictional character.
